Handover note — Crumbwheel order cutoffs.

Welcome aboard. The bakery cutoff rule in Crumbwheel closes same-day orders at 14:00 local to each storefront, not UTC — this has bitten us twice. Holiday overrides live in the calendar service and take precedence silently, so always check there first when a cutoff looks wrong. To unlock the calendar service's admin console after a restart, enter the recovery passphrase below.

vault phrase of bagap-bahaf = silion-pelox-sorox-casdor-quenwyn-fraax-eliox-praael-kelion-quenvan-kasox-rusael-norius-belvan

Since Tuesday, the Wayfarer mobile apps have been falling back to the web experience because the deep-link resolution service, Lodestar, rejects token exchange with a 401. Investigation showed the router's credential for the internal Lodestar mapping API expired after the standard 90-day window, and no rotation reminder fired because the calendar hook was removed during the migration. For future maintainers: rotation must now be tracked in the ops checklist. A replacement has been issued and is recorded below.

service key, kaduf-bawig: kto15_Ze79S0dligTw0yO

## Step 4: Swap the fixture source

Before enabling Forgeling as the test-data factory, confirm the legacy SeedBench jobs are paused; running both will double-insert fixtures and corrupt the smoke suite. Point the factory at the staging replica first, verify row counts, then promote. Once verified, apply the service configuration below exactly as written, line for line.

deployment values, yadug-bawif:
[framir]
team = pelox
access_code = ac_a38ab2
owner = tamion.julael
host = framir.tolvaqlabs.test
port = 11211
peer = tammir.zemvargrid.local
salt = 2215ef03
pin = 1541

TICKET #—Vault lockout, Brindlewood staging

Quota service can't read per-tenant rate limits because the config vault sealed itself after three failed unseal attempts. Tenants currently fall back to global defaults (200 rps), which is too generous for trial accounts. New contractors: don't touch the quota overrides until the vault is open. Unseal from the ops bastion, then reload the quota daemon. Use the recovery passphrase below.

unlock words, bahop-fawef: novmir-druwyn-soriel-rusdor-kasion